John Leyton


John Leyton was born on Feb. 17th 1939 at Frinton-On Sea, Essex, England, to parents of show business background. His father owned several cinemas and his mother acted under the name of 'Babs Walters' on the London stage. Trivia:

John Leyton started his career as Johnny Leyton, making two U.K. top ten records in the early sixties before attempting to cross over into films. See more »
